The Foundation: 2016-2020 Financial Journey

Justin Rose established himself as a golf powerhouse during this period. In 2016, he consistently delivered top performances, including strong finishes at the U.S. Open and multiple PGA Tour victories. Industry analysts placed the couple's combined wealth between $35 million and $40 million at that time.

Rose earned substantial income from tournament prize money and partnerships with global brands. Meanwhile, Kate Phillips focused on charitable initiatives, building their philanthropic reputation alongside their financial portfolio.

The year 2018 marked a significant milestone. Justin Rose achieved the World Number 1 ranking and captured the FedEx Cup title. These accomplishments brought substantial bonuses and enhanced sponsorship opportunities. By the end of the decade, their estimated net worth reached approximately $45 million.

Even the COVID-19 pandemic in 2020 couldn't derail their financial stability. While Rose played fewer tournaments that year, their prior earnings and reliable sponsorship deals maintained their strong position. Analysts estimated their wealth remained in the $45-48 million range during this challenging period.
